Manuel Da Costa

Software Engineer at Genius Sports

Geneva, Geneva, Switzerland
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

👤
Senior
🎓
Top School
Manuel Da Costa is a software engineer with eight years of experience in full-stack development and DevOps, with a strong focus on open science and research data platforms. As a maintainer of CERN's Zenodo and active contributor to the InvenioRDM project, he has guided feature development and production operations for a global repository used by 400,000 researchers across 161 countries, delivering an estimated 100 million CHF/year socio-economic impact. His hands-on work spans frontend (JavaScript/React), backend (Python), and infrastructure, including fixes to search, deposit workflows, and URL routing, along with platform upgrades. He has led cloud architecture efforts and microservices migrations in previous roles and contributed to EU health-data sharing portals and IPBX web applications, demonstrating a track record of delivering scalable, user-centric systems. Based in Geneva, Switzerland, he is currently a Software Engineer at Genius Sports, bringing his open-source and research-driven experience to a high-growth, data-centric environment.
code9 years of coding experience
job2 years of employment as a software developer
bookMaster of Science - MS, Computer Systems Networking and Telecommunications, Master of Science - MS, Computer Systems Networking and Telecommunications at Aristotle University of Thessaloniki (AUTH)
bookMaster of Science - MS, Computer Science, Master of Science - MS, Computer Science at Universidade de Aveiro
bookVerified Certificate, Economics, Online Certificate, Verified Certificate, Economics, Online Certificate at University of California, Irvine
languagesSpanish, Portuguese, English, French
github-logo-circle

Github Skills (19)

javascript10
javascripts10
react10
back-end-development9
python9
front-end-development9
backend9
frontend-development9
back-end9
api8
api-doc8
postgresql7
html6
html46
html56

Programming languages (6)

SmartyShellCSSJavaScriptHTMLPython

Github contributions (5)

github-logo-circle
Turn-key research data management platform.
Role in this project:
userFull-stack Developer
Contributions:94 reviews, 11 commits, 48 PRs in 8 months
Contributions summary:Manuel contributed to multiple aspects of the Invenio RDM platform. They fixed a search bar issue, updated community types, and added funding and award functionalities to the deposit form. They also upgraded the platform, fixed file list styling and added a URL redirector feature. The commits span across frontend (JavaScript, React), backend (Python), and configuration aspects.
data-managementpythonresearch-dataidentity-managementdata-management-platform
alejandromumo/invenio-github

Jul 2022 - Aug 2024

GitHub integration for Invenio.
Contributions:2 PRs, 44 pushes, 17 branches in 2 years 1 month
invenio
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Manuel Da Costa - Software Engineer at Genius Sports